The swing arm is back from the machine shop, suitably modified so as to fit the SRAD frame.
Next job was to remove the SRAD's top suspension mounting bracket and make a pocket for the ride height control arm to run in, like so...........

Image


Image

then I cut a template for the new suspension upper mounting brackets...........

Image

this was sent away for 2 replicas to be water-jet cut from 10mm aluminium sheet.

and whilst I awaited their return, I made a pair of bearing support brackets..........

Image

Image

Image
